**Alert: tailfox CLI — tail session failures**

The tailfox CLI is failing to open tail sessions against the Greymarsh log brokers. Error rate above 30% for 15 minutes. Release impact: deploy verification relies on live tails, so holds may be needed. Workaround: use the batch-pull mode until sessions recover. Triage steps and current broker status are tracked on the page below.

dashboard of bajef-bageg = https://confluence.lumiclabs.internal/browse/browse/pages/display/93ae

/*
 * Sets up the client for the Brimvale firmware update channel.
 * Heads up: this talks to the internal Flashline service, not the
 * public CDN, so don't point customer devices at it. The channel
 * serves staged firmware builds for the Kestrel-9 units only —
 * other models will 404 and that's expected. Retries are handled
 * by the client, so no need to wrap calls yourself. If updates
 * stall, check the Flashline status page first. The service key
 * you need is right below.
 */

app token of yajeg-kawef = kto11_7En3XSX8xQw

## Changelog — Harborline Gateway 4.2

### Changed defaults: upstream circuit breaker

The circuit breaker guarding the Tidemark upstream API now trips faster and recovers more conservatively. Support should expect shorter error bursts but longer half-open probing windows during incidents. Customers previously seeing cascading timeouts will instead get immediate fallback responses. No action is needed on existing deployments. The new default values are as follows.

settings of yageg-yahap:
[gorael]
team = olieth
access_code = ac_941d74
owner = brieth.aldiel
host = gorael.tolvaqio.internal
port = 6379
peer = briwyn.urlaqtech.internal
salt = 116e6622
pin = 1957

Q: How do I book the wellness room for someone on my team? A: Use the Roomboard panel outside the door on level three of the Carradine Building. Bookings run in 30-minute blocks, maximum two per day per person. The door stays locked between sessions; once a booking starts, it can be opened with the code below.

turnstile pass: bdg-TXR-4